Address NEs68H2st4BYJX9UcTpcAMVdMGcS4RBPSk

Total received 29.04582624 NMC
Total sent 29.04582624 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
April 19, 2023, 10:55 a.m. 504623cc1… 661500 29.04582624 NMC 0.00000000 NMC
April 19, 2023, 10:49 a.m. 8b80b4188… 661499 29.04582624 NMC 29.04582624 NMC